Simon Heck has Been Appointed as Director General of CIP and CGIAR Senior Director

The World Potato Congress Inc.’s (WPC) Board of Directors congratulates Dr. Simon Heck on his appointment as the future Director General of the International Potato Center (CIP), headquartered in Lima, Peru.
For the past ten years, Simon has directed the CIP sweet potato initiative, which has reached over seven million homes, predominantly in Africa, with bio-fortified sweet potatoes. He is also known for his unusual ability to have research results promptly tested and, if successful, quickly adapted and implemented by farmers and stakeholders in a variety of nations.
“Both the World Potato Congress Board of Directors and the global team under the direction of Dr. Heck have similar missions as we fulfill objectives designed to improve global food security. The WPC has benefited greatly from the ongoing support of CIP,” Dr. Peter VanderZaag, WPC President, said.
Dr. Simon Heck will begin his new position on March 1, 2023. Dr. Oscar Ortiz, who served as Interim Director General, will remain as CGIAR Senior Director for Crop-based Systems in Lima.
